this tractor my great grandfather  bought from Mr Bill Longs fathers dealership, pap went back to spread a load of manure with his wd and when he came back through the gate he jumped off to shut the gate and turned around and an old cow was rubbing her neck on the rear tire he tried to stop it but couldnt. it went down the hill and into a small stream. he fixed it up and used it until mt dad sold it .more pics to come if you want to see them.....Jb
